- Details of Event
- Two colliers were taking an empty tram down a dip road and when near a stall in which deceased was working allowed it to run so as to clear a slight rise in the road. Instead of running straight on, it jumped off the road at the pointers of the stall where deceased was and crushed him fatally. He died on the following day. The colliers were very much to blame for allowing the tram its freedom on a dip of 2.5ins. per yard.
